One of my favorite blogs is Yes and Yes. It’s filled with positivity (just look at the title) and great To Do lists and little quips of joy and inspiration that make you want to go out and take on the world – in a positive way.

The writer of the blog puts out a Year in Yes calendar. I ordered one this year and it is so much fun. It has random holidays you didn’t know existed, days ear marked with cool things to do or try (Cultivate a new laugh on January 25th or Learn the names of clouds on May 14th, for example). Each month also has a specific list about yourself to write out. And a place at the bottom to keep note of the things that happened that month that you loved.

The list for this month is: New Things I’ll Try This Year.
